Skills to become a Django Developer

  • Python: A strong command of the Python programming language is essential since Django is a Python web framework.
  • Django Framework: Thorough understanding of the Django framework, including its models, views, templates, forms, and routing mechanisms.
  • Database Management: Proficiency in working with databases, especially with database systems commonly used with Django such as PostgreSQL, MySQL, or SQLite.
  • Frontend Technologies: Familiarity with HTML, CSS, and JavaScript is necessary for developing user interfaces and integrating frontend components.
  • Version Control/Git: Experience with version control systems like Git to manage codebase changes and collaborate effectively with other developers.
  • API Development: Knowledge of building and consuming RESTful APIs for communication between different parts of an application or with external services.
  • Testing and Debugging: Ability to write unit tests and conduct effective debugging to ensure the reliability and performance of your code.
  • Security Best Practices: Understanding of web security principles, including input validation, protection against SQL injection, cross-site scripting (XSS), and other common vulnerabilities.
  • Deployment and Hosting: Familiarity with deploying Django applications on servers, using tools like Docker, Heroku, AWS, or other cloud platforms.
  • Command Line: Proficiency in using the command line interface (CLI) for tasks like managing dependencies, running scripts, and interacting with development tools.

Average Django developer salaries in India

  • Junior Django Developer: Entry-level developers with around 1-2 years of experience could expect a salary ranging from ₹2.5 lakh to ₹5 lakh per annum.
  • Mid-Level Django Developer: Developers with 2-5 years of experience might earn anywhere from ₹5 lakh to ₹10 lakh per annum.
  • Senior Django Developer: Those with more than 5 years of experience could command salaries ranging from ₹10 lakh to ₹20 lakh or more per annum.

Factors influencing django developer salaries

The salary of a Django developer, like any other profession, is influenced by a variety of factors. These factors can vary from region to region and from one company to another. Here are some of the key factors that can influence the salary of a Django developer.

  • Experience: The level of experience a Django developer has is a significant determinant of their salary. Developers with more years of experience generally command higher salaries due to their expertise and ability to handle complex projects.
  • Location: Salaries can vary greatly depending on the city or region in which the developer works. Major tech hubs and cities with a higher cost of living tend to offer higher salaries to attract and retain talent.
  • Company Size: The size of the company can also play a role. Larger companies or well-funded startups may have bigger budgets for developer salaries compared to smaller businesses.
  • Type of Company: The type of company can make a difference. Tech companies, e-commerce giants, and product-based companies may offer different salary structures compared to digital agencies, consulting firms, or freelancing projects.
  • Demand and Supply: The demand for Django developers in the job market can influence salaries. If there’s a shortage of skilled Django developers, salaries might be higher due to increased competition for available talent.
  • Education and Certifications: A developer’s educational background and any relevant certifications can impact their earning potential. Advanced degrees, relevant certifications, or even contributions to open-source projects can enhance a developer’s value.
  • Responsibilities: The specific role and responsibilities within a development team can influence salary. A lead developer, for example, may earn more than a junior developer due to the higher level of responsibility.
  • Remote vs. On-Site: With the rise of remote work, some companies offer remote positions. Salaries for remote developers might be influenced by factors such as the location of the company headquarters, the developer’s location, and the company’s remote work policies.
  • Economic Conditions: The overall economic conditions of the country or region can impact salary trends. Inflation, economic growth, and market demand can affect how companies budget for developer salaries.
  • Negotiation Skills: Lastly, a developer’s negotiation skills during the hiring process can impact their final salary offer. Those who are skilled negotiators might secure a higher compensation package.

Lucrative opportunities for Django developers in India

As of my last update in September 2021, Django developers in India have several lucrative opportunities across various sectors due to the growing demand for web applications and digital services. Here are some areas where Django developers can find lucrative opportunities in India.

 

  • E-commerce: With the booming e-commerce industry in India, there’s a high demand for web developers to build and maintain online shopping platforms. Django’s robustness and scalability make it a suitable choice for building e-commerce websites.
  • Fintech: The financial technology sector has been rapidly expanding in India, with companies offering digital payment solutions, banking services, and investment platforms. Django developers with skills in handling secure transactions and financial data can find rewarding opportunities in this field.
  • Healthcare: The healthcare industry is increasingly adopting digital solutions, from patient management systems to telemedicine platforms. Django developers can contribute to building HIPAA-compliant applications that streamline healthcare services.
  • EdTech: The education technology sector has seen significant growth, especially with the adoption of online learning platforms and remote education. Django developers can help create interactive and user-friendly e-learning platforms.
  • Travel and Hospitality: The travel and hospitality industry often requires web applications for booking, reservations, and travel management. Django developers can play a vital role in creating seamless online experiences for travelers.
  • Startups: India’s startup ecosystem is vibrant, and many startups are focused on technology-driven solutions. Django developers can find exciting opportunities to work on innovative projects and potentially be part of the growth journey of a new company.
  • Digital Agencies: Digital marketing agencies and creative studios often require developers to build websites and web applications for their clients. Django developers can collaborate with designers and marketers to create engaging online experiences.
  • Government Projects: Government initiatives for digital transformation and e-governance create opportunities for developers to work on projects that improve public services and administrative processes.
  • Freelancing and Consulting: Freelancing or consulting can be a lucrative option for Django developers, allowing them to work on a variety of projects for different clients while setting their own rates.
  • SaaS (Software as a Service): Developing and maintaining SaaS platforms is another area where Django developers can thrive. Building subscription-based software solutions for various industries can lead to steady income streams.
  • Data Analytics and Visualization: Django developers who specialize in data visualization and analytics platforms can find opportunities in industries like marketing, finance, and research.
  • IoT (Internet of Things): As IoT applications grow, Django developers with skills in building web interfaces for IoT devices can contribute to smart home, industrial automation, and healthcare solutions.

FAQ’s

1.What is the average salary for a Django developer in India?

The average salary for a Django developer in India can vary based on factors like experience, location, skillset, and company size. As of my last update in September 2021, junior developers might earn around ₹2.5 lakh to ₹5 lakh per annum, mid-level developers could earn between ₹5 lakh to ₹10 lakh per annum, and senior developers might earn ₹10 lakh or more per annum.

2.Do Django developers earn more than other web developers?

Django developers often command competitive salaries due to the specific skillset required to work with the Django framework. However, salaries can vary based on factors such as location, demand, and the developer’s overall skillset, which includes frontend and backend technologies.

3.What are the key factors that influence Django developer salaries?

Django developer salaries are influenced by factors like experience, location, skillset (both Django-specific and related technologies), company size, demand for developers in the market, and negotiation skills.

4.Is remote work affecting Django developer salaries?

Remote work can impact salary dynamics. Developers who work remotely for companies in regions with higher salaries might earn more than developers working for local companies. However, remote work can also lead to global competition, potentially affecting salary ranges.

5.Do Django freelancers earn as much as full-time developers?

Freelance Django developers have the potential to earn competitive rates, especially if they have a strong portfolio and specialized skills. However, freelancing might also involve fluctuations in income and less stability compared to full-time positions.

6.Are Django developer salaries expected to increase over time?

Salaries for Django developers could potentially increase over time due to the growing demand for web applications and digital services. However, the rate of increase can depend on economic conditions, industry trends, and other factors.
